Senior Speech Pathologist

Senior Speech Pathologist – East Victoria Park

Make a Big Impact While Loving What You Do!

Are you ready to take the next step in your Speech Pathology career? At Early Start Australia (ESA), we’re seeking an experienced and passionate Senior Speech Pathologist to join our dynamic East Victoria Park team. This is an exciting opportunity to work with a diverse paediatric caseload, supporting children with developmental delays and disabilities through tailored therapy programs and Early Childhood Early Intervention.

What You’ll Do

  • Deliver evidence-based assessment and therapy across clinic, home, school, and telehealth settings.
  • Collaborate closely with families to help children achieve their developmental goals.
  • Mentor and support junior clinicians, sharing your expertise and fostering professional growth.
  • Enjoy full administrative support, allowing you to focus on clinical excellence.

What’s In It For You

  • A positive, inclusive, and supportive team culture – with regular social events and celebrations.
  • Rostered CPD hours, structured supervision, and access to in-house professional development.
  • Discipline-specific and transdisciplinary training, plus mentoring from industry leaders.
  • Paid professional development leave and paid parental leave.
  • Attractive performance incentives and employee benefits, including discounts on groceries, movie tickets, and more!

What You’ll Bring

  • Tertiary qualifications in Speech Pathology and current SPA membership.
  • Proven experience working with paediatric clients and/or disability services.
  • Strong leadership skills and a passion for mentoring others.
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ills to thrive in a culturally diverse environment.

About Us

Early Start Australia is a national multidisciplinary allied health organisation committed to delivering evidence-based early intervention and therapy services to children and their families. We’re passionate about making a real difference and creating a workplace where you feel supported, valued, and inspired.

As part of the APM Group, ESA offers the best of both worlds – a small practice feel with corporate support and job security, so you can focus on delivering quality care.
